1核2G服务器能否运行Windows Server 2019?结论与详细分析
结论:1核2G的服务器可以勉强安装Windows Server 2019,但实际运行性能极低,仅适合极轻量级任务或测试环境,不推荐用于生产环境。
Windows Server 2019的最低硬件要求
微软官方给出的Windows Server 2019最低硬件要求如下:
- CPU:1.4 GHz 64位处理器(至少1核)
- 内存:512 MB(带桌面体验需2 GB)
- 存储:32 GB可用空间
从纸面参数看,1核2G满足最低要求,但实际体验会非常糟糕。
1核2G运行Windows Server 2019的潜在问题
-
性能严重不足
- 单核CPU:Windows Server 2019默认会运行多项后台服务(如更新、日志、安全扫描),单核CPU极易满载,导致系统卡顿。
- 2GB内存:仅能勉强启动系统,运行任何额外服务(如IIS、SQL Server、AD域)都会导致内存耗尽,触发频繁的磁盘交换(Pagefile),进一步拖慢速度。
-
功能限制
- 若安装“桌面体验”版本(带GUI),内存占用更高,可能无法正常使用。
- 多任务处理能力极差,例如同时运行Web服务+数据库几乎不可能。
-
稳定性风险
- 内存不足可能导致服务崩溃或系统无响应。
- 安全更新或补丁安装时,资源占用激增,可能引发宕机。
适用场景(仅限极端情况)
- 临时测试环境:例如学习Active Directory基础操作或验证某个配置。
- 超轻量级服务:运行一个静态网页或极低流量的API(需关闭所有非必要服务)。
- 无GUI模式:使用Server Core(无图形界面)可减少资源占用,但管理复杂度增加。
优化建议(若必须使用)
- 关闭所有非必要服务:禁用Windows Update、Defender、日志收集等。
- 使用Server Core版本:减少内存占用约30%-50%。
- 限制后台进程:通过
msconfig或PowerShell禁用启动项。 - 优先使用SSD:缓解内存不足导致的磁盘交换延迟。
更合理的替代方案
- 升级配置:至少2核4G才能流畅运行基础服务。
- 改用Linux:相同配置下,Linux(如Ubuntu Server)资源占用更低,适合轻量级应用。
- 容器化部署:如需运行Windows应用,可考虑Docker+Windows容器(仍需更高配置)。
总结
1核2G服务器能“跑”Windows Server 2019,但几乎无法“用”。 除非是短期测试,否则强烈建议升级硬件或选择更轻量级的系统方案。
秒懂云